Watchdog Task Manager Lite keeps your phone’s background apps in check by monitoring their behavior and letting you kill only the misbehaving ones. It has a solid 4.38 rating from 43,118 reviews and over 1,000,000+ installs, offering a safer alternative to blanket task killers. The Lite edition includes ads, while the Pro upgrade unlocks a blacklist feature for CPU-threshold-based control.

About Watchdog Task Manager Lite
Watchdog Task Manager Lite was a tools app developed by Zomut, LLC. It was removed from Google Play Aug 18, 2018 and is no longer available for download.
Download Statistics
Watchdog Task Manager Lite had been downloaded 2.2 million times before it became unavailable.
User Ratings
Watchdog Task Manager Lite was rated 4.38 out of 5 stars, based on 43 thousand ratings.
App Information
Watchdog Task Manager Lite was free to download. The APK download size was 626.07 kB. The last available version was 3.6.7. The last update was on February 7, 2012.
Technical Requirements
Watchdog Task Manager Lite required Android 1.5+ or higher. The app had a content rating of Everyone. The app had been available on Google Play May 2010.

Trust & Safety: Permissions requested include ACCESS_NETWORK_STATE, INTERNET, KILL_BACKGROUND_PROCESSES, RECEIVE_BOOT_COMPLETED, RESTART_PACKAGES, VIBRATE, and WAKE_LOCK. These align with its goal of monitoring and managing background apps, but users should review the requested permissions and use the app in accordance with app-store safety guidance.
